German-Uruguayan Dialogue on Agriculture launched

The German-Uruguayan Dialogue on Agriculture is funded by the Federal Ministry of Food and Agriculture (BMEL) and implemented by IAK Agrar Consulting GmbH (lead partner) in a consortium with AFC Agriculture and Finance Consultants GmbH. After the project began its work in November, the operational kick-off meeting and planning workshop took place on Dec 6, 2023 in Montevideo, Uruguay. On the premises of the Uruguayan Ministry of Livestock, Agriculture and Fisheries (MGAP), representatives of the MGAP, the National Institute of Agricultural Research (INIA), the GFA, the project team and the IAC spoke about the project's implementation strategy and the indicative work plan for the inception phase. The participants agreed that the project offers great opportunities for the exchange of knowledge and experience between political and scientific actors in Uruguay and Germany. It also became clear that the promotion of products from deforestation-free supply chains should play a special role.

The expert dialogue is intended to help promote the development of sustainable, agroecological and climate-resilient agricultural production systems in both countries. As part of the expert dialogue between political and scientific institutions, innovative, resource-conserving and climate-friendly measures in the agricultural sector will be discussed and concrete recommendations for action developed. To this end, the following measures will be implemented:

  • Promotion of scientific cooperation between the Julius Kühn Institute and the INIA
  • Establishment of a bilateral political and technical dialogue between the BMEL and the MGAP
  • Regional networking and dissemination of the results of the dialogue in Latin America

The topics to be addressed in the dialogue include soil protection, hemp fibres, honey, agricultural advisory systems and gender equality. For the latter measure, networking with other partner projects of the BMEL's Bilateral Cooperation Programme (BKP) in South America and with supra-regional agricultural research networks is being sought. These include the German-Brazilian Agricultural Policy Dialogue and the German-Argentine Dialogue on Sustainable Agricultural Innovations, both of which are being implemented under the leadership of the IAK. The results of the project are to be made accessible to a supra-regional target group through targeted communication and public relations work.
